Service Brakes problem #1

My car was part of recall number 22v465, which was supposed to fix a problem with the electronic brake assist system. The recall repair was done in 2023, but after my battery recently died, the same problem has come back — my brakes are very firm, and I have to press hard to stop. The car is showing trouble codes c028f:04, c1586:04, and v0420:71, all related to the electronic brake control module.

Service Brakes problem #6

The contact owns a 2018 Buick Regal. The contact received notification of NHTSA campaign number: 22v465000 (service brakes, hydraulic) however, the part to do the recall repair was unavailable. The contact stated that the manufacturer had exceeded a reasonable amount of time for the recall repair. The contact stated while attempting to depress the brake pedal excessive amount of pressure was needed to depress the brake pedal to bring the vehicle to a stop. The failure was more evident while reversing the vehicle. The failure was intermittent.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 28,000. VIN tool confirms parts not available.
